Thông tin sản phẩm
The pattern below illustrates how a “bill of materials” can be created for use by other projects. The reference information about the dependency management tags is available from the project descriptor reference. Sometimes in the past an implementation has been labeled “UCS-2” to indicate that it does not support supplementary characters and doesn’t interpret pairs of surrogate code points as characters. Such an implementation would not handle processing of character properties, code point boundaries, collation, etc. for supplementary characters, nor would it be able to support most emoji, for example.
- A just-in-time inventory system is a management strategy that aligns raw-material orders from suppliers directly with production schedules.
- UTF-8 is the most widely used ASCII-compatible encoding form for Unicode.
- This issue not only affects complex scripts, but also seemingly simple things like emoji.
- E-signature software can reduce paper costs and improve productivity across departments.
The assessment tool is free to anyone and is designed to help organizations better understand the evolution of their data and … The co-creator of the open source project at Facebook reflects on 10 years of growth as he helps lead one of its resulting tools …
Get Started
You can see references and their instances combined into parent-child relationships. OpenBOM provides a super-efficient and easy-to-use user interface to view, control, and collaborates around the Bill of Materials. OpenBOM’s CAD integrations are ready to “plug in” and have been built using the best-in-class technology. You can easily import your Bills of Materials, CAD files and derivatives from your favorite CAD software in minutes using OpenBOM plugins. The following examples show how bom can process different sources to generate an SPDX Bill of Materials. Multiple sources can be combined to get a document describing different packages. Bom can take a deeper look into images using a growing number of analyzers designed to add more sense to common base images.
Managing dependencies for multi-module projects and applications that consist of hundreds of modules is possible. Maven helps a great deal in defining, creating, and maintaining reproducible builds with well-defined classpaths and library versions. Both Unicode and ISO have policies in place that formally limit future code assignment to the integer range that can be expressed with current UTF-16 .
Files
Hence, the process accessing the text can examine these first few bytes to determine the endianness, without requiring some contract or metadata outside of the text stream itself. Generally the receiving computer will swap the bytes to its own endianness, if necessary, and would no longer need the BOM for processing.
More wet weather and flooding on way: BOM – Crikey
More wet weather and flooding on way: BOM.
Posted: Thu, 21 Jul 2022 07:00:00 GMT [source]
This type can be used to track which subcomponents have been serviced or replaced. For example, an EBOM may list parts related to a specific https://accounting-services.net/ function of the product, such as chips for a circuit board. An MBOM lists every material that goes into manufacturing a product.
Production Planning
The first hierarchical databases were developed for automating bills of materials for manufacturing organizations in the early 1960s. At present, this BOM is used as a data base to identify the many parts and their codes in automobile manufacturing companies. Ease of use, such as unrolling all the inner BOMs of a given end product, to facilitate the management of complex BOMs where many levels are involved. Data entry sanitization, e.g. to prevent circular dependencies – where a part appears as one of its inner requirements – from being entered in the first place. Revision-controlled items and BOMs ensure you can produce and deliver high-quality products. Over the past decades, we have focused 100% on helping businesses worldwide improve theirproduct configuration and configurability.
- Complex data management requirements, custom integration CAD, PDM, PLM, ERP and more.
- Here, version 1.1 of a would be used since X is declared first and a is not declared in Z’s dependencyManagement.
- However, you will have significant challenges to fulfill the needs of all the functions.
- Yes, there are several possible representations of Unicode data, including UTF-8, UTF-16 and UTF-32.
- If your systems and your required functionality allow it, the Modular BOM approach is likely to have the lowest total cost over time.
Many systems are only capable of using a so-called Super BOM, which is a BOM that has predefined rows for all possible configurations. However, as I explain further in this blog, this way of working is not always practical for end-to-end product configuration.
JS References
Data enrichment, for example by associating manufacturing lead times to the BOM structure, in order to provide a more fine grained perspective on the underlying process modeled through the BOM. In remanufacturing and maintenance, BOMs represent materials that might be needed to perform repairs. In such situations, the quantities given by the BOM are merely upper bounds on the materials that may ultimately be needed. Depending on the state of the repairable component, repairs usually only require a fraction of the BOM to be completed, although the exact quantities aren’t typically known until the repair is completed. Second, you should always try to minimize the number of Product Masters per function. This minimization reduces the effort to create and maintain masters, and it simplifies the integration and synchronization along the flow of systems.
- OpenBOM provides a super-efficient and easy-to-use user interface to view, control, and collaborates around the Bill of Materials.
- The Unicode Standard used to contains a short algorithm, now there is just a bit distribution table that shows the relation between surrogates and the resulting supplementary code points, but does give an algorithm.
- The standard also does not recommend removing a BOM when it is there, so that round-tripping between encodings does not lose information, and so that code that relies on it continues to work.
- For more in-depth instructions on how to create an SBOM for your project, see”Generating a Bill of Materials for Your Project”.
- There is a specific item for each purchased item and any manufactured or pre-assembled items outside the main assembly flow.